The joyous season of summer not only offers radiant sunshine, balmy weather, and extended daylight hours but also gifts us a bounty of fresh produce. One of the most cherished summer delights is the corn on the cob. The sweet and juicy crunch of a corn cob is a taste of summer that we all wish could last forever. As the corn season draws to an end, we often find ourselves longing for this succulent treat. Fortunately, there’s a way to preserve this summer joy so that you can savor corn on the cob during fall and winter too.

Once your corn is prepared, directly place the cobs into freezer bags or vacuum seal them to lock in the freshness. The key here is to make sure the corn is well-sealed before you freeze it.
